Describe your experience with crop rotation and its benefits.
- Answer: I understand the importance of crop rotation for soil health and pest management. I've participated in implementing rotation plans, which has resulted in improved soil fertility, reduced pest and disease incidence, and increased yields. I'm familiar with planning rotations based on nutrient needs and pest cycles.
-
How familiar are you with integrated pest management (IPM) techniques?
- Answer: I am familiar with IPM principles and have practical experience in implementing them. This includes monitoring pest populations, using biological controls like beneficial insects, employing cultural practices to minimize pest pressure, and using pesticides only as a last resort and following all safety guidelines.

Describe your experience with irrigation methods.
- Answer: I have experience with [List irrigation methods, e.g., drip irrigation, furrow irrigation, sprinkler irrigation]. I understand the principles of water management and can adjust irrigation techniques based on crop needs, soil type, and weather conditions to optimize water use efficiency and prevent water stress or overwatering.

How do you ensure the quality of harvested crops?
- Answer: I prioritize careful harvesting techniques to avoid damaging the produce. I inspect crops for maturity and quality before harvesting, ensuring only the best products are selected. I understand the importance of proper handling, storage, and transportation to maintain freshness and prevent spoilage.
-
What is your experience with soil testing and its role in crop production?
- Answer: I'm familiar with the process of soil sampling and understand how soil test results inform fertilizer application and soil amendment strategies. I understand the importance of soil pH, nutrient levels, and organic matter content in optimizing crop growth and yield.

How do you identify and address common crop diseases and pests?
- Answer: I can identify common diseases and pests through visual inspection and have experience in implementing control measures such as preventative practices, cultural controls, biological controls, and when necessary, the responsible use of pesticides according to label instructions and safety protocols.
-
What is your experience with post-harvest handling and storage of crops?
- Answer: I am experienced in proper post-harvest handling, including cleaning, sorting, grading, and packing produce to maintain quality and extend shelf life. I understand the importance of appropriate storage conditions, such as temperature and humidity control, to prevent spoilage.
